Lucene:修订间差异
外观
删除的内容 添加的内容
小 *修正了版本 *添加了基于Lucene的项目 |
Guoxiao281(留言 | 贡献) 更新链接,去除无关链接 |
||
第37行: | 第37行: | ||
*[http://lucene.apache.org/ Lucene homepage] |
*[http://lucene.apache.org/ Lucene homepage] |
||
*Article "[http://blog.dev.sf.net/index.php?/archives/10-Behind-the-Scenes-of-the-SourceForge.net-Search-System.html Behind the Scenes of the SourceForge.net Search System]" by [[Chris Conrad]] |
*Article "[http://blog.dev.sf.net/index.php?/archives/10-Behind-the-Scenes-of-the-SourceForge.net-Search-System.html Behind the Scenes of the SourceForge.net Search System]" by [[Chris Conrad]] |
||
* |
* {{cite web |archive-date= Jul 2006 |archive-url= https://web.archive.org/web/20060715234923/schmidt.devlib.org/software/lucene-wikipedia.html |url= http://schmidt.devlib.org/software/lucene-wikipedia.html |quote= Introductory article with Java code for search |title= Lucene Wikipedia indexer |first= Marco |last= Schmidt |date= 2005 }} |
||
*[http://www.budget-ha.com/lucene Simple Lucene Examples] |
*[http://www.budget-ha.com/lucene Simple Lucene Examples] |
||
* [http://apiwave.com/java/zhwiki/api/org.apache.lucene Apache Lucene popular APIs] in [[GitHub]] |
|||
*[http://www.chedong.com/tech/lucene.html Lucene:基於Java的全文檢索引擎簡介] |
|||
{{Apache}} |
{{Apache}} |
2016年12月13日 (二) 14:58的版本
開發者 | Apache Software Foundation |
---|---|
当前版本 | 6.3.0(2016年11月8日 | )
源代码库 | |
编程语言 | Java |
操作系统 | Cross-platform |
类型 | 搜索及全文检索 |
许可协议 | Apache许可证 2.0 |
网站 | lucene |
Lucene是一套用于全文检索和搜尋的開放源碼程式庫,由Apache软件基金会支持和提供。Lucene提供了一個簡單卻強大的應用程式介面,能夠做全文索引和搜尋,在Java开发环境裡Lucene是一個成熟的免費開放原始碼工具;就其本身而論,Lucene是現在並且是這幾年,最受歡迎的免費Java資訊檢索程式庫。
历史
Lucene最初是由Doug Cutting所撰寫的,他是一位資深的全文索引及檢索專家,曾經是V-Twin搜索引擎的主要開發者,後來在Excite擔任高級系統架構設計師,目前從事於一些INTERNET底層架構的研究。他貢獻出Lucene的目標是為各種中小型應用程式加入全文檢索功能。
基於Lucene的項目
- Apache Nutch — 提供成熟可用的网络爬虫[1]
- Apache Solr — 基于Lucenne核心的高性能搜索服务器,提供JSON/Python/Ruby API[2]
- Elasticsearch —企业搜索平台,目的是组织数据并使其易于获取[3]
- DocFetcher — 跨平台的本机文件搜索桌面程序[來源請求][4]
- Lucene.NET — 提供给.Net平台用户的Lucene类库的封装[5]
- Swiftype — 基于Lucene的企业级搜索[6]
- Apache Lucy — 为动态语言提供全文搜索的能力,是Lucene Java 库的C接口[7]
- Luke — Java编写的用户界面用于编辑Lucene的索引,此项目已停止开发[8]
參見
- Solr - 使用Lucene的企業搜索伺服器,亦由Apache軟件基金會所研發。
外部連結
- Lucene homepage
- Article "Behind the Scenes of the SourceForge.net Search System" by Chris Conrad
- Schmidt, Marco. Lucene Wikipedia indexer. 2005. (原始内容存档于Jul 2006).
Introductory article with Java code for search
- Simple Lucene Examples
- Apache Lucene popular APIs in GitHub
- ^ dev@Nutch.apache.org. Apache Nutch™ -. nutch.apache.org. [2016-11-29].
- ^ What are the main differences between ElasticSearch, Apache Solr and SolrCloud? - Quora. quora.com. [23 September 2015].
- ^ Elasticsearch: RESTful, Distributed Search & Analytics - Elastic. elastic.co. [23 September 2015].
- ^ Quang, Tran Nam. DocFetcher - Fast Document Search. docfetcher.sourceforge.net. [2016-11-29].
- ^ Apache Lucene.Net. lucenenet.apache.org. [2016-11-29].
- ^ Swiftype - Site search and enterprise search. Swiftype. [2016-11-29].
- ^ Apache Lucy. lucy.apache.org. [2016-11-29].
- ^ luke. GitHub. [2016-11-29].